Algonquin Nissan dealers along with Nissan dealers around the country are anxiously awaiting the official release of the Nissan LEAF. The first of two electric cars to be mass-produced, (GM's Volt being the second) will "hit" dealer lots by the end of this year.
Hit is in quotations because LEAF vehicles will not actually make it to a lot display. All of the highly anticipated environmentally friendly vehicles being produced this year have already been spoken for. One particularly lucky LEAF will go to none other than Lance Armstrong.
And oh is he excited, and rightfully so. In a recent youtube video, the world-famous cyclist speaks about the importance of the LEAF in a different manner than most people probably consider. For Lance, the introduction of an electric, fume-free vehicle provides hope that one day all vehicles will run in this fashion. For a cyclist that shares the road with vehicles - riding behind their tailpipes and breathing in the polluted air - a world of electric vehicles means a healthier office space.
In the video, Mr. Armstrong attempts to drive home his point about the negative effects car pollution has on his sport by bringing up the Olympic Games in Beijing. Athletes noticeably suffered due to the smog in China because they were unable to use their full lung capacity. Lance claims being a cyclist who rides behind cars is a little like riding in Beijing everyday.
In the video Lance says, "the air quality is a significant issue. If we continue down the path that we're on, that's just going to get worse." He isn't talking just about the small industry of cycling either. Armstrong says "we as a society" need to rethink how we live and pollute. His desire to support Nissan is due to the fact that Nissan is producing a product that has the ability to be the catalyst for this much needed change.
